Understanding Press Release Structure

Before you start writing a press release, you need to understand its basic structure. A press release typically consists of the following sections:

  • Headline: This is the most important part of your press release, as it captures the attention of your readers and summarizes the main point of your news. It should be short, catchy, and informative.
  • Summary: This is a brief paragraph that expands on the headline and provides more details about your news. It should answer the 5 Ws: who, what, when, where, and why.
  • Date and Location: This is where you indicate the date and location of your news. It should be formatted as “City, State/Country (PRWEB) Month Day, Year”.
  • Body: This is the main content of your press release, where you provide more information and context about your news. It should be written in an inverted pyramid style, meaning that the most important information comes first, followed by less important details. It should also include quotes from relevant sources, such as your company spokesperson, customers, or partners, to add credibility and a human touch.
  • Company Description: This is a short paragraph that introduces your company and its mission, vision, and values. It should also include a link to your website and social media channels.
  • Boilerplate: This is a standard disclaimer that informs the readers that the information in your press release is not a guarantee of future performance or results, and that it may contain forward-looking statements that are subject to risks and uncertainties.
  • End or Close: This is where you indicate the end of your press release. It should be marked with three hash symbols (###) or the word “END”.

Following this structure is important for clarity and professionalism, as it helps your readers understand your news and its significance. It also helps journalists and editors who may want to cover your story or use your press release as a source.

Writing a Compelling Headline with AI

The headline is the first thing that your readers see when they encounter your press release, so it needs to be compelling and effective. A good headline should:

  • Keep it short: A headline should be no longer than 10 words or 65 characters, as longer headlines may get cut off or ignored by search engines and readers.
  • Include numbers or statistics: Numbers or statistics can help you quantify your news and make it more specific and credible. For example, instead of saying “Company X Launches New Product”, you can say “Company X Launches New Product That Increases Sales by 50%”.
  • Avoid generalizations: Generalizations can make your headline vague and boring, and may not convey the value or uniqueness of your news. For example, instead of saying “Company X Announces Partnership with Company Y”, you can say “Company X Announces Exclusive Partnership with Company Y to Deliver Innovative Solutions”.
  • Use keywords: Keywords are the words or phrases that your target audience is likely to use when searching for your news or topic. Using keywords can help you optimize your headline for SEO and match the search intent of your readers. For example, if your news is about a new AI-powered press release writing tool, you can use keywords like “AI”, “press release”, and “writing tool”.

Crafting a Clear and Concise Summary

The summary is a brief paragraph that expands on the headline and provides more details about your news. It should answer the 5 Ws: who, what, when, where, and why. A good summary should:

  • Align with the headline: The summary should not contradict or deviate from the headline, but rather support and elaborate on it. For example, if your headline is “How AI Can Help You Write a Press Release in Minutes”, your summary should explain how AI can do that, and not talk about something else.
  • Summarize complex content: The summary should not include too much technical or jargon-heavy content, but rather simplify and condense it for your readers. For example, if your news is about a new AI-powered press release writing tool, your summary should not go into the details of how the tool works, but rather focus on the benefits and features of the tool.

Enhancing Press Releases with AI-Generated Quotes

Quotes are an essential part of press releases, as they can add credibility and a human touch to your news. Quotes can come from various sources, such as your company spokesperson, customers, partners, or industry experts. A good quote should:

  • Be relevant and authentic: The quote should be related to your news and reflect the genuine opinion or experience of the source. For example, if your news is about a new AI-powered press release writing tool, your quote should not talk about something unrelated, like the weather or politics, but rather about how the tool helped or impressed the source.
  • Be impactful and memorable: The quote should be catchy and memorable, and convey a strong message or emotion. For example, if your news is about a new AI-powered press release writing tool, your quote should not be bland or generic, like “The tool is good”, but rather something more specific and powerful, like “The tool is a game-changer for press release writing”.
